Read-Aloud Tips

One of the best ways to help children with their language skills (whatever the language) is to read aloud to them. Here are a few tips to help your children get the most from your reading times together.
  • Read slowly. Give your children time to build the scene of the story in their minds.
  • Use different voices. This makes the story more fun and helps your children keep track of the characters in the story.
  • Stop and discuss. Books are to be interacted with. Take time with your children along the way to discuss, predict, question, and comment on what you are reading.
